Does improving indoor air quality lessen symptoms associated with chemical intolerance?

Roger B PeralesRaymond F PalmerRudy RinconJacqueline N ViramontesTatjana WalkerCarlos R JaénClaudia S Miller
Published in: Primary health care research & development (2022)
Improvements in both IAQ and patients' symptoms occur when families implement an action plan developed and shared with them by a trained EHC team. Indoor air problems simply are not part of most doctors' differential diagnoses, despite relatively high prevalence rates of CI in primary care clinics. Our three-question screening questionnaire - the BREESI - can help physicians identify which patients should complete the QEESI. After identifying patients with CI, the practitioner can help by counseling them regarding their home exposures to VOCs. The future of clinical medicine could include environmental house calls as standard of practice for susceptible patients.
